San Joaquin County, California <br /> A.P.N. 207-090-01, Property Address: 9654 South Henry Road, <br /> Minor Sub Number: 91-17 <br /> [1] EXECUTIVE SUMMARY <br /> This Soil Suitability Study presents the results of our <br /> investigation concerning the soil strata under the subject property <br /> referenced above. This study was performed to determine if this <br /> site is acceptable for septic systems in terms of posing no adverse <br /> environmental impact to the underlying groundwater. This study is <br /> in compliance with the requirements of Section 9-10100 (c) of the <br /> San Joaquin County Ordinances. <br /> [2] SUBJECT SITE BACKGROUND INFORMATION <br /> The subject site consists of four parcels that are 41. 33 acres <br /> each. Each parcel is approximately 1397 feet by 1292 feet. There <br /> are currently no improvements to the subject property, and it is <br /> used primarily as pasture land for cattle grazing. There are no <br /> records of any structures that previously existed on the subject <br /> property. This property is considered an antiquated subdivision <br /> and is currently zoned AL-40. <br /> The topography of the subject site is relatively flat with a slight <br /> "rolling hills" terrain. The site is bound to the north, south and <br /> west by open agricultural land that is presently utilized as <br /> pasture. To the east is a defunct chicken egg layer ranch <br /> (Kleinfeld Ranch) that had a septic systems. On July 8, 1970, <br /> there was a leach line failure at this ranch that was inspected by <br /> Jim Miller. On March 22 , 1970, Permit Number 71-218 was issued to <br /> install additional length leach lines and seepage pits per San <br /> Joaquin County Codes. <br /> O (\)uniih� � mlru� Jr�s�mctum <br />
